The 'Heart' of Health Care Reform: Can the Law Stand Without a Mandate? - Yahoo! News
news.yahoo.com — “From Yahoo! News: During the summer of 2009, when the health care reform debate was dividing the country and the "public option" seemed like the most important policy issue in a generation, the proposal to require all Americans to have health insurance was hardly ever mentioned. The individual mandate, now the focus of a historic Supreme Court review, was just one part of a complex and broad overhaul of the nation's health care system. Medicare cuts, end-of-life counseling and a tax on” View full resource at news.yahoo.com

Medicare Could Save Billions by Permanently Adopting Primary Care Payment Increase, Says Study -- AAFP News Now -- American Academy of Family Physicians
aafp.org — “The Medicare program could save billions of dollars by permanently extending a temporary provision in the health care reform law that provides a five-year, 10 percent Medicare payment boost for primary care services.” View full resource at aafp.org
